Akwatia MP Bernard Bediako Baidoo has criticised former Vice President and 2028 New Patriotic Party (NPP) flagbearer Dr Mahamudu Bawumia over his call for the release of Techiman-based nurse Salomey Awiti Bafoh.
Bafoh, a 40-year-old senior nursing officer and mother of three, was arrested on September 13 and later charged with abetment of crime, specifically the alleged publication of false news, under Sections 20(1) and 208 of the Criminal Offences Act, 1960 (Act 29).
The prosecution alleges that she acted as a liaison for Barbara Asantewaa Kodua, popularly known as “Ghana Jollof”, and helped recruit people to redistribute videos from the TikTok account. Kodua, who is believed to be in the United Kingdom, has been declared wanted by the police.
The Adenta Circuit Court denied Bafoh bail and remanded her for two weeks, with the case expected to return to court on September 30.
Reacting to the development in a social media post on Friday, September 18, Dr Bawumia described the circumstances surrounding Bafoh's arrest and subsequent remand as worrying and raised concerns about the protection of free speech.
Dr Bawumia further assured intelligence agencies will not be used to pursue citizens merely for insulting political leaders under his presidency.
He also noted that while he does not support political insults, any infringement on the right to free expression would undermine Ghana's democracy.
However, speaking on Accra-based Metro TV's Good Morning Ghana on the same day, Bediako Baidoo accused the former Vice President of applying a different standard to the current case despite his record while in government.
He argued that Dr Bawumia, as a former Vice President, had the opportunity to influence how similar cases were handled but did not do anything.
“When you[Dr. Bawumia] had the power to change things, you didn't do it. Now you are outside. You are now throwing stones and then appearing as though you are a saint. Be truthful,” he said.
